-- Multithreaded Hello World server

require"zmq"
require"zmq.threads"
require"zhelpers"
local worker_code = [[
local id = …
local zmq = require"zmq"
require"zhelpers"
local threads = require"zmq.threads"
local context = threads.get_parent_ctx()
-- Socket to talk to dispatcher
local receiver = context:socket(zmq.REP)
assert(receiver:connect("inproc://workers"))
while true do
local msg = receiver:recv()
printf ("Received request: [%s]\n", msg)
-- Do some 'work'
s_sleep (1000)
-- Send reply back to client
receiver:send("World")
end
receiver:close()
return nil
]]
s_version_assert (2, 1)
local context = zmq.init(1)
-- Socket to talk to clients
local clients = context:socket(zmq.ROUTER)
clients:bind("tcp://*:5555")
-- Socket to talk to workers
local workers = context:socket(zmq.DEALER)
workers:bind("inproc://workers")
-- Launch pool of worker threads
local worker_pool = {}
for n=1,5 do
worker_pool[n] = zmq.threads.runstring(context, worker_code, n)
worker_pool[n]:start()
end
-- Connect work threads to client threads via a queue
print("start queue device.")
zmq.device(zmq.QUEUE, clients, workers)
-- We never get here but clean up anyhow
clients:close()
workers:close()
context:term()
